Phone number ☎️ 02038969835 👆 is reported as a persistent scam originating from fake HMRC callers, often using automated messages that threaten legal action or arrest for alleged tax fraud. The calls typically feature suspicious accents and demand urgent callbacks, intending to frighten recipients into divulging personal or financial information. Many users have confirmed these are fraudulent, emphasising that HMRC would never initiate contact or threats in this manner. The number is frequently associated with criminal operations based overseas, utilising spoofed UK numbers to deceive the public. It is strongly advised not to engage with the callers, avoid sharing any details, and report the number to the police and official HMRC phishing teams for investigation. Blocking the number is a recommended precaution to prevent further nuisance calls.

It really freaked me out at first, but I ended up hanging up since I checked online and realised it was a scam.HMRC6 yearsLoads of those scam calls come from India and they often use spoofed UK numbers. So it’s pretty rare to hear them speaking Urdu, which is more usual in Pakistan or Kashmir. Anyway, any scam call you get should definitely be reported on the police website. Just Google ‘Action Fraud’, then pick the ‘police.uk’ site and head to the ‘reporting’ bit. Mark it down as a phishing fraud and you don’t even need to sign up. You can also let the HMRC phishing team know by using the link you’ll find on this page, just above the map showing hotspots.IndiaUKPakistanKashmirGoogleHMRC6 yearsI got a call from someone claiming to be with hmrc, asking for my husband. About 02 Numbers
These numbers are connected to specific locations in the UK and are typically used by domestic and commercial premises. Frequently termed as 'basic rate', 'local rate', or 'national rate' numbers, the charges for these geographic numbers are predicated on the time of day. Most service providers offer call packages that include free calls during designated times. Call costs from mobile phones are based on the chosen calling plan, with many plans including these numbers in their free call packages.
